Globalization and
Economic Integration
Globalization fosters economic integration across the world. The
formation of trade blocs like the European Union (EU), the North
American Free Trade Agreement (NAFTA), and now the United States-
Mexico-Canada Agreement (USMCA) has allowed easier trade between
member countries.
Introduction of Globalization and Economic
Integration
Globalization refers to the interconnectedness of nations through trade, investment, and technology. Economic integration
involves removing barriers to trade and investment between countries.

Shifts in Global Trade Patterns
Globalization has led to significant changes in global trade patterns. Developing countries are playing a more prominent role in
global trade, particularly in manufacturing and exports.

Global Supply Chain
Reconfigurations
Globalization has led to the emergence of complex global supply chains.
Companies are sourcing raw materials, manufacturing components, and
distributing finished goods across the world.

Impact of Globalization on
Indian Economy
India has experienced significant economic growth due to globalization.
The country has become a major destination for foreign investment and a
key player in global trade.
Increased FDI
1 India has received significant foreign direct investment,
boosting its economy and creating jobs.
Export Growth
2 India has increased its exports of goods and services,
contributing to its economic growth.
Job Creation
3 Globalization has created new jobs in various sectors,
leading to increased employment opportunities.
